Protesters shut Brega once again

Libya : Protesters have blocked the oil port of Brega in eastern Libya, just days after it reopened for the first time in close to a year.
Rebels in Libya’s east said they would keep open the country’s largest oil port, Es Sider, and dissociated themselves from the Brega protest.

“This incident, in the port of Brega, has no impact on the agreement with the government to open Es Sider and Ras Lanuf,” said Ali al-Hasy, a spokesman for the self-declared Executive Office for the Barqa region. “We stand by the agreement with the government. Es Sider and Ras Lanuf will stay open.”  [14/07/14]
